#4e4ba9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4e4ba9 is composed of 30.6% red, 29.4% green and 66.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.8% cyan, 55.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 33.7% black. It has a hue angle of 241.9 degrees, a saturation of 38.5% and a lightness of 47.8%. #4e4ba9 color hex could be obtained by blending #9c96ff with #000053.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#4e4ba9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030306 is the darkest color, while #f8f7f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#4e4ba9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7a7a7a is the less saturated color, while #1109eb is the most saturated one.
